What is the second oldest settlement in South Africa


Stellenbosch

The second oldest town in South Africa, founded by Simon van der Stel in 1679 and renowned for its Cape Dutch buildings, university and wines, Stellenbosch lies in a fertile valley surrounded by vineyards, orchards and mountains.

What is the oldest settlement in South Africa

Cape Town

Cape Town. The Mother City is the oldest city in South Africa and therefore boasts many of the oldest places and buildings. Jan van Riebeeck of the Dutch East India Company (VOC) braved the Cape of Storms by ship in 1652 and it initially served as a stopover when travelling from the Netherlands to the East.

Is Port Elizabeth South Africas second oldest city

The second-oldest colonial city in South Africa, Port Elizabeth, has a new name. It mixes some of the unique linguistics of the Xhosa language, yet many South Africans are struggling to pronounce it.
